With over 3,000 nominations for 2020 Under 30 Forbes list, the 30 most outstanding Africans in 2020 under age 30 have now been listed by Forbes.
The outstanding Africans are nominated and chosen from across the African continent but looking at this year’s list one is quick to notice that Nigerians dominate the list.
Below are some Nigerians that made the list, take a look:
. DJ Cuppy, 27, DJ, Founder and Director, Red Velvet Music Group
Industry: Entertainment
2. Mr Eazi, 28, Musician and Founder, emPawa Africa
Industry: Entertainment
3. Patoranking, 29, Musician
Industry: Entertainment
4. Tracy Batta, 29, Co-founder and Chief Executive Officer, Smoothie Express
Industry: Food and Beverage
5. Olajumoke Oduwole, 29, Founder and CEO and Senior Web Developer, KJK Communication Limited
Industry: Tech / software development
6. Swanky Jerry, 28, Founder, Chief Creative Officer, Swanky Signatures
Industry: Fashion
7. Davies Okeowo, 29, Co-founder and CEO, Enterprise Hill and Competence Africa
Industry: Business Development
8. Maryam Gwadabe, 29, Founder and CEO, Blue Sapphire Hub
Industry: ICT
9. Asisat Oshoala, 25,Footballer
Industry: Sports
